Describe the bug
Since last version, the memory used by NPM grows up around 25 MB per day.
Nginx Proxy Manager Version
v2.12.1
To Reproduce
Nothing to do... Only one active proxy host.
Expected behavior
Stable memory consumption, like the previous version.
Screenshots
Operating System
Raspberry Pi 4B with 4 GB RAM, OS updated:
Linux raspberrypi 6.6.51+rpt-rpi-v8 #1 SMP PREEMPT Debian 1:6.6.51-1+rpt3 (2024-10-08) aarch64 GNU/Linux
Additional context
I see the memory consumption through "Monitor Docker" integration in Home Assistant.
